Output 4a5886efc4f7ad14b2b452a98b813547f1deabd0ce1ea70d4d0b682c73f50b29:1

value
1238872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b2a662bd877a80d8f0a660cb5dab799887da88 OP_EQUAL
address
3QBSAYqg5HMJz2wgEPAeyBoYAfESFwjmaz
transaction
4a5886efc4f7ad14b2b452a98b813547f1deabd0ce1ea70d4d0b682c73f50b29
confirmations
330467
spent
true